Link Alias Issues in Content Blocks
We have 16 different franchise brands that we market for individually. I have content blocks set up for all of our branded footers (multiple design options for each brand) that I use on every email. We were really excited to have content blocks so we could easily update standard footer elements and links without having to update it on all of our live emails for every brand (there are hundreds), but it seems that building all these content blocks will still not be useful for making universal updates bc if I change a link, I still have to go into every single email of every live canvas and campaign to retype the link alias name - a very tedious an unnecessary process that essentially defeats the purpose of the content blocks in the first place. Does anyone know if it's possible to specify the link alias name in the HTML of my content blocks (or even just in my HTML email templates) for the UI to recognize the alias name automatically so I won't have to manually name the same link in every email? I know that aliases are unique to each email, but this is not useful at all when we have standard links that are on all emails that I'm naming the same thing every time anyways. There has to be a better option than "all or nothing" on the link alias enablement bc we want to use it. But the benefits of the content blocks are being cancelled out by the link aliases. We put a lot of work into rebuilding all these templates/blocks for all of our brands when we migrated to Braze, so I really want to find a way to make it work.299Views0likes4Commentsmultiple subscription group update
Adding subscription group to your email program is a great way to retain customers from on overall exit. Unfortunately adding the program starts all existing customer as unsubscribe. Luckily there is a webhook to switch them on, unfortunately I am only able to switch on ONE at a time. Has anyone attempted to switch multiple subscription group at a time?654Views0likes7CommentsRequest: Save Email as Template
I would love to have the ability to utilize emails I've created in campaigns in Canvases. But the only way to do that is to export the email out of campaign as a .zip file and then import it into templates. This then removes the best part of the email creation and editing process: drag and drop! So then I can no longer edit the email in the canvas without digging into the code. Anyone else have this problem? This is a feature I've been able to use in other email marketing services like hubspot! Would love a "save email as template" dropdown option. Or, when I'm creating a canvas, be able to select emails that I've created in campaigns.989Views6likes4Commentsre-loop canvas or template for multiple send
Hi All, Has anyone done a re-loop in the canvas where one customer would get the same message multiple times. Not trying to spam the customer but for transactional purpose where they would need to get the same template multiple times based on the number of accounts a customer might have or event a customer runs through. Currently, I duplicate the template and do a decision split to evaluate if they have multiple. If they do then they will get the duplicate template with the second account data and so forth. For simple 1 or 2 template communication that's easy but we also have a canvas with 23 templates and duplicating that multiple times just leave room for error. Curious if anyone has done it a better way Thank you ^-^31Views0likes1CommentFind matched filter group in Canvas step
Is there a way to find which filter group a user matched when matching a step in a canvas? Ideally I want to use the returned events data which is in USERS_CANVASSTEP_PROGRESSION_SHARED or something like that, but I can only find a reference to the canvas_step_api_id, not anything internal to the step node itself apart from its name. Thanks64Views0likes8CommentsMachine vs. Other in Audience Segment Filters
Hello everyone! I work with a freelance client with specific defined audience goals. I'm blocked with an issue within the current segment filters to ensure zero overlaps but want to see if there's anything I'm missing or if anyone has a suggestion for me. Audience groups and qualifications 1: New or active (within 120 days as defined by "created_at") This group is defined as someone who has other opened within 120 days OR machine opened BUT ALSO clicked within 120 days OR their "created_at" date is within 120 days. 2: Lapsed/Dormant This group would be someone who has done a verifying action to confirm their "real" but those actions are older than 120 (they have other opened more than 120 days ago or machined opened AND clicked more than 120 days ago). 3: Inactive / Never engaged This would ideally cover everyone else. They've never other opened but may have machine opened but never clicked. If they have never other opened, or machine opened but didn't click, and the created_at date is within 120 days, they'd be in the first group until that 121 day mark. Challenges 1: Someone can have both a "last other opened" and "last machine opened" within different time frames. 2: The Braze segment filters allow for AND and OR statements but those groups must use all AND or OR statements. I can't define more complex "if this, then that" scenarios such as [created_at is more than 12 days] AND [[last other opened more than 120 days ago] OR [last machine opened AND clicked more than 120 days ago] OR [machine opened never]]. This is possible in Mailchimp and I'm fairly certain in other ESPs (combining and/or statements within larger and/or statements). 3: You can't have more than 1 segment that refers to another segment. (I can't define group 1, then define group 2 but also exclude group 1 if there's an overlap). Any suggestions or recommendations on how to get these first two audience groups into a segment with zero overlap?27Views0likes2CommentsWhat’s the best approach for an NPS survey?
Hey everyone 👋 I’m planning to add an NPS survey to an email campaign and I’m curious — what’s worked best for you? Email with a link to a Braze landing page with the survey Or an embedded survey directly in the email? Both options will consume data points to collect information from each user, but which do you think has more advantages overall? Would love to hear your experiences! 🙌79Views1like3CommentsHelp with Tracking Pixel Placement in Braze Emails
Hi Braze Community, I’m looking for guidance regarding tracking pixel placement in Braze emails. By default, the pixel is placed at the bottom of the email, but we’ve noticed that some of our longer emails are getting clipped by Gmail, which seems to be impacting our open rate tracking. I’ve seen that there’s an option to move the tracking pixel to the top of the email, which could potentially resolve this issue. Before applying this change across all campaigns, I’m wondering: Is there a way to test this change in the NonProd environment first? Alternatively, can we apply this change to selected email campaigns only for testing purposes? Also, our emails typically have Liquid logic positioned at the top. Would moving the tracking pixel above this logic cause any issues with rendering or data capture? Has anyone tried this approach before? Would love to hear your experiences or best practices. Thanks in advance!71Views4likes2Comments